How to print on M2070W from Linux (better wireless)?

 

I wanna be able to print directly from my Linux Mint 22.1.

 Install Required Packages

Ensure that you have the necessary packages installed on your Linux system. Open a terminal and enter the following command:

sudo apt install hplip hplip-gui cups

Download HPLIP

Download the latest version of HPLIP (HP Linux Imaging and Printing) from HP’s official website here.

Alternatively, you can update HPLIP directly via the terminal:

sudo apt update
sudo apt upgrade hplip

Run HPLIP Setup

Once HPLIP is installed, run the setup command in the terminal:

sudo hp-setup

Follow the on-screen instructions to configure your HP printer for wireless printing. Ensure your printer is powered on and connected to the same Wi-Fi network as your computer.

Add Printer

In the terminal, start HPLIP GUI by entering:

hp-toolbox
  • Click Add Device.
  • Choose Network/802.11 Wireless from the connection options.
  • Allow the application to search for available printers, select your HP M2070W printer, and follow the instructions to complete the wireless setup.

Configuring CUPS (Optional)

Sometimes configuring CUPS (Common Unix Printing System) directly can help manage printing services effectively.

  1. Open CUPS web interface by navigating to http://localhost:631 in your web browser.
  2. Click Adding printers and classes and select Add Printer.
  3. You should see your HP M2070W listed under Discovered Network Printers or Discovered Printers. Select it and follow on-screen steps to install the driver and setup.
